Best Quotes about Change

1.
The changes in our life must come from the impossibility to live otherwise than according to the demands of our conscience not from our mental resolution to try a new form of life.
Tolstoy, Count Leo

2.
With me a change of trouble is as good as a vacation.
George, David Lloyd

3.
Change is not made without inconvenience, even from worse to better.
Hooker, Richard

4.
Change tends to be viewed as a threat to our control.

5.
A rut is a grave with no ends.
Lampkin, Alan

6.
Change hurts. It makes people insecure, confused, and angry. People want things to be the same as they've always been, because that makes life easier. But, if you're a leader, you can't let your people hang on to the past.
Marcinko, Richard

7.
Thus all things are doomed to change for the worse and retrograde.
Virgil

8.
The primary and most beautiful of Nature's qualities is motion, which agitates her at all times, but this motion is simply a perpetual consequence of crimes, she conserves it by means of crimes only.
Sade, Marquis De

9.
Things do not change, we do.
Thoreau, Henry David

10.
Some people change their ways when they see the light, others when they feel the heat.
Schoeder, Caroline

11.
Things do not change; we change.
Henry David Thoreau

12.
Change is inevitable. Change for the better is a full-time job.
Stevenson, Adlai E.

13.
We are restless because of incessant change, but we would be frightened if change were stopped.
Bryson, Lyman L.

14.
For changes to be of any true value, they've got to be lasting and consistent.
Robbins, Anthony

15.
Many deceive themselves, imagining they'll find happiness in change.
Kempis, Thomas

16.
Life may change, but it may fly not; Hope may vanish, but can die not; Truth be veiled, but still it burneth; Love repulsed, -- but it returneth.
Shelley, Percy Bysshe

17.
It is change, continuing change, inevitable change, that is the dominant factor in society today. No sensible decision can be made any longer without taking into account not only the world as it is, but the world as it will be. This, in turn, means that our statesmen, our businessmen, our every man must take on a science fictional way of thinking.
Asimov, Isaac

18.
To change and change for the better are two different things
Proverb, German

19.
It is a dangerous thing to reform anyone.
Wilde, Oscar

20.
There is such a thing as a general revolution which changes the taste of men as it changes the fortunes of the world.
La Rochefoucauld, Francois De

21.
If you don't like how things are, change it! You're not a tree.
Rohn, Jim

22.
Goals allow you to control the direction of change in your favor.
Tracy, Brian

23.
Everything flows and nothing abides, everything gives way and nothing stays fixed.
Heraclitus

24.
Life is a series of natural and spontaneous changes. Don't resist them -- that only creates sorrow. Let reality be reality. Let things flow naturally forward in whatever way they like.
Lao-Tzu

25.
Only I can change my life. No one can do it for me.
Carol Burnett

26.
Perfection is immutable. But for things imperfect, change is the way to perfect them.
Felltham, Owen

27.
People can cry much easier than they can change.
Baldwin, James

28.
Changes start occurring when budgets are cut.

29.
Being willing to change allows you to move from a point of view to a viewing point -- a higher, more expansive place, from which you can see both sides.
Crum, Thomas

30.
The first step toward change is awareness. The second step is acceptance.
Branden, Nathaniel

31.
You must welcome change as the rule but not as your ruler.
Waitley, Denis

32.
They must change who would be constant in happiness and wisdom.
Confucius

33.
Believe, if thou wilt, that mountains change their place, but believe not that man changes his nature.
Mohammed

34.
The moment of change is the only poem.
Rich, Adrienne

35.
That things are changed, and that nothing really perishes, and that the sum of matter remains exactly the same, is sufficiently certain.
Bacon, Francis

36.
Change can either challenge or threaten us. Your beliefs pave your way to success or block you.
Sinetar, Marsha

37.
The universe is change; our life is what our thoughts make it.
Marcus Aurelius Antoninus

38.
It seemed that each time we would become proficient at a given task there would be a change made for no apparent reason. It sometimes appeared that changes were made simply because sufficient time had elapsed since the last change. And then our efforts would begin again from the beginning.
Adalphos, General

39.
Change, like sunshine, can be a friend or a foe, a blessing or a curse, a dawn or a dusk.
Ward, William A.

40.
We live in an era when rapid change breeds fear, and fear too often congeals us into a rigidity which we mistake for stability.
White, Lynn

41.
Life has got a habit of not standing hitched. You got to ride it like you find it. You got to change with it. If a day goes by that don't change some of your old notions for new ones, that is just about like trying to milk a dead cow.
Guthrie, Woody

42.
The fish only knows that it lives in the water, after it is already on the river bank. Without our awareness of another world out there, it would never occur to us to change.

43.
Only man is not content to leave things as they are but must always be changing them, and when he has done so, is seldom satisfied with the result.
Huxley, Elspeth

44.
Force never moves in a straight line, but always in a curve vast as the universe, and therefore eventually returns whence it issued forth, but upon a higher arc, for the universe has progressed since it started.
Kabbalah

45.
The most serious charge that can be brought against New England is not Puritanism but February.
Krutch, Joseph Wood

46.
Who we are never changes. Who we think we are does.
Almanac, Mary S.

47.
Man must be prepared for every event of life, for there is nothing that is durable.
Menander of Athens

48.
Slumber not in the tents of your fathers. The world is advancing.
Mazzini, Giuseppe

49.
People who wait for changes to occur on the outside before they commit to making changes on the inside will never make any changes at all.

50.
As the blessings of health and fortune have a beginning, so they must also find an end. Everything rises but to fall, and increases but to decay.
Sallust
